The Calgary Wranglers were once the shining star of the North American Conference, but that is not the case anymore as the team has entered into a period of rebuild and transition. The Wranglers have not been in the finals since S46, as they entered a period of rebuilding after their S47 playoff loss to the New York Americans. Fortuneately for Calgary, the north remembers the proud history of the Wranglers, and the pieces are being put in place for Calgary to become cup-contenders once again. While the team clearly will not be winning any cups this season, they have some great prospects who look to develop into key players, and I will highlight each of them in this piece.

Jace Hines

 

My acqusition of Jace Hines reminds me of my acquisition of Philthethrill's player (I am too lazy to look up the player name) way back in the day. I gave up some lower round picks for Hines, and similiar to Philthethrill he is a quieter guy who may not be a tpe whore, but @HF92 is consistently earning tpe, and I see Hines as a key player for now and as he continues to improve into the future. Hines leads Calgary with 13 points, and as an S45 prospect he is still young enough that he has plenty of room to keep getting better. If Hines continues to stay active, my trade for him could be a part of #MakeCalgaryGreatAgain
